This book is a modest attempt to reminisce the author's career as a PTD officer. The author have served 46 years as a government servant, 35 years as a PTD officer and 11 years as the Auditor-General of Malaysia. Not many officers have served that long in the service of the nation. The Pegawai Tadbir & Diplomatik Service(PTD) has been hailed as the nation’s premier service, as successor to the Malaysian Home and Foreign Service (MHFS) in 1972. The MHFS was the successor to the Malayan Civil Service (MCS) in 1966, which was set up in 1921 by the British Colonial Administration. The PTD and its precursors, the MCS and the MHFS, have played a pivotal and strategic role in national development since the nation attained its independence in 1957. It has been responsive to the political leadership of the day, always mindful of its political neutrality obligation. Coincidently, the year 2021, the year the author's little book is published, marks the 100th Anniversary of the MCS and the PTD. Unfortunately, not much has been written about the PTD and MCS. To the best of his knowledge, there were four books written about the PTD/MCS, namely ‘At the Forefront of Nation Building’ by Sheens Gurbakhash & Fiona Ghaus; ‘Taking The Road Less Travelled’ by Datuk Dr Shaari Ahmad Jabar; ‘Service Par Excellence’ by Datuk Wan Mansur Abdullah; and ‘Tun Abdullah Ayub’ by Fatini Yaacob and Toh Puan Anna Abdul Ranee.
